Excellent opportunity for a Data Privacy Lawyer to join a British household name. The purpose of the role is to primarily lead on Data Privacy globally for the business, both in an advisory and operational capacity. It is an exciting time to join the business as AI in this sector as well as industry regulatory changes mean the business is investing in these areas and as a result, the business needs excellent legal judgment, strong technical knowledge and a highly commercial approach.
This role will deputise the DPO and be the go-to person for all Privacy matters affecting the global business. It will suit an individual looking for a hands-on role with significant stakeholder engagement, whilst also acting as the lead data privacy advisor to a number of complex privacy matters affecting a global, well recognised brand. The company is headquartered outside London. However, an excellent company car package is also on offer.
The ideal candidate will have the following:
- Substantial experience of working within a complex Data Privacy environment, either in-house or with a reputable law firm.
- Solid understanding of European Privacy rules (including GDPR) affecting a technology focused global organisation.
- UK or European Legal qualification.
- Demonstrable experience of influencing senior stakeholders.
- Ability to work with a global business.
